The Japanese government has decided to remove restrictions on entry into the country from October 11 due to the situation related to the spread of the coronavirus.
Axar.az reports that Prime Minister Fumio Kishida said this at a press conference in New York.
The head of the government also said that from that day, various campaigns are planned to stimulate domestic tourism in the country, including discounts for visiting various entertainment events.
